Pluto Finance has raised 拢500m (鈧571m) from institutional investors for a UK residential development lending fund.
Blackstone and Clearbell Capital have for the alternative lender, which has been active since 2011.
The new fund will provide senior debt, bridging loans and stretched senior finance to UK housing developers.
Pluto Finance partner Justin Faiz said the company is providing 鈥渓ower leverage senior debt鈥 with interest rates from 3.95%, which, he said, is 鈥渃heaper than the challenger banks, and competitive with the clearing banks but with a much faster turnaround time鈥.
Jonathan Morgan, director of investment and developments of Galliard Homes, said the developer is in 鈥渁dvanced discussions to take Pluto鈥檚 new senior loan facility on a number of projects鈥.
Pluto Finance provides senior loans between 拢3m and 拢30m up to 60% loan to value (LTV), as well as stretched senior loans between 拢5m and 拢50m up to 80% LTV. Bridge loans between 拢1m and 拢10m are offered up to 75% of current use value.
The company has recently appointed four staff to its lending team.
